CXCR2/IL-8RB Products

CXCR2/IL-8RB is a member of the CXC chemokine receptor subfamily. Similar to other chemokine receptors, it is a G protein-coupled receptor (GPCR). Human CXCR2/IL-8RB is 360 amino acids (aa) in length with a predicted molecular weight of 41 kDa. The human protein shares 71% aa sequence identity with the mouse and rat protein. CXCR2/IL-8RB is expressed on neutrophils and activates neutrophil chemotaxis.

Similar to the closely related CXCR1/IL-8RA, CXCR2/IL-8RB binds and mediates CXCL8/IL-8-induced neutrophil activation. It also binds additional CXC chemokine ligands that contain an ELR aa motif. CXCR2/IL-8RB is implicated in neurological and pulmonary inflammatory diseases and injury. As such, it is a therapeutic target of interest in inflammatory disease and cancer.
